rear end gears

I have done a total rebuild on the engine in my 84 f-250 with trick flow heads and cam and is bored 30 thousandths I replace the aod tranny with a jackson racing c6 which is rated to handle 500 hp. I am having trouble getting off the line as fast as I would like. Would this be caused by going from the 4 speed aod to the 3 speed c6. And was wondering what size gears I would need to go to in the rearend to compensate for this and still be able to cruz at about 60mph if possible. Right now I have an 8.8 w/ 3.55 gears (i think) and am running 265/75/16 mud tires......thanks for the help

The taller tires with the car gearing are the biggest problem. To get faster response, 4.10's or 4.56's are best, but it sacrifices highway cruise rpm's, as it will make you run higher revv's to go the same speeds.

for the last 2 weeks, I was rolling on 265/70R17's, with a C6 and 4:10 gears, I was turning 3300 rpm's at 65mph. I now have 285/70R17's, and turn 3000rpm's at 65mph. You could also run a smaller tire when racing and keep your gears, that will get you off the line quicker.
